Python Engineer - INTL India

Post Date

Aug 11, 2025

Location

Summit,
New Jersey

ZIP/Postal Code

07901
US
Oct 22, 2025 Insight Global

Job Type

Contract-to-perm

Category

Software Engineering

Req #

NNJ-801549

Pay Rate

$16 - $20 (hourly estimate)

Job Description

Insight Global is seeking a skilled Software Engineer to support integration efforts for Malbek, Keelvar and other procurement technology products and platforms. This role is focused on making sure data from various systems is properly formatted and structured so it can flow seamlessly into Malbek. Youll work closely with Business Analysts, Validation Leads and Configuration Support team to understand how data needs to be transformed, then use tools like Python, SQL, and Excel macros to automate and streamline those processes. Youll be responsible for building scripts, troubleshooting integration issues, and ensuring the data is clean, consistent, and ready for use. The work done by the Software Engineer will be critical in preparing the data for successful integration and downstream use. This is a hybrid role working onsite in Bengaluru, India.

We are a company committed to creating in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ity employer that believes everyone matters. Qualified candidates will receive consideration for employment opportunities without regard to race, religion, sex, age, marital status, national origin, sexual orientation, citizenship status, disability,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to Human Resources Request Form. The EEOC "Know Your Rights" Poster is available here.

To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/ .

Required Skills & Experience

5-8 years experience in a Software Engineering role.
Strong proficiency in Python for scripting, data transformation and automation.
Solid experience with SQL for data querying and transformation.
Experience working with REST APIs, system integration workflows and data pipelines.
Ability to work independently and solve complex data formatting challenges.

Nice to Have Skills & Experience

Experience with CLM (Contract Lifecycle Management) platforms.
Familiarity with Excel macros for data manipulation and reporting.

Benefit packages for this role will start on the 31st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.